The purpose of this experiment is to map invisible electric fields using conductive paper, a voltage source, and probes to measure potential differences on the paper, which are always perpendicular to electric field lines showing force direction and strength. One end of the u probe has an electrical ball that is pressed against the resistive board on the underside of the mapping board. the other end of the u probe is on the top of the mapping board and has a hole that allows you to make a pencil mark on a piece of paper.

In this lab activity, you will make measurements of the electric potential throughout a region of space, and then use these equipotentials to map out the electric field in this region. From a complete electric eld map the charge density variations on the electrodes themselves can be deduced. on your paper grids provided, carefully draw the outlines of the electrodes at the same positions as they appear on the black conductive paper. To visualize the electrostatic potentials and fields in some physically interesting situations. our goal is to explore the electric potential in the region of space around some conductors of specified shape, which are held at specified potentials by batteries or some such device.
